[00:00.000]Lesson 2: Thirteen equals One
[00:02.740]New Concept English
[00:02.942]Listen to the tape, then answer the question below:
[00:05.797]Was the vicar pleased that the clock was striking? Why?
[00:24.395]Our vicar is always raising money for one cause or another,
[00:31.403]but he has never managed to get enough money to have the church clock repaired.
[00:42.826]The big clock which used to strike the hours day and night
[00:48.741]was damaged many years ago and has been silent ever since.
[01:04.002]One night, however, our vicar woke up with a start,
[01:09.720]the clock was striking the hours!
[01:16.306]Looking at his watch, he saw that it was one o'clock,
[01:22.031]but the bell struck thirteen times before it stopped.
[01:28.349]Armed with a torch, the vicar went up into the clock tower to see what was going on.
[01:41.522]In the torchlight, he caught sight of a figure whom he immediately recognized as Bill Wilkins, our local grocer.
[02:08.680]'Whatever are you doing up here Bill?' asked the vicar in surprise.
[02:21.917]'I'm trying to repair the bell,' answered Bill.
[02:28.439]'I've been coming up here night after night for weeks now.
[02:35.421]You see, I was hoping to give you a surprise.'
[02:47.996]'You certainly did give me a surprise!' said the vicar.
[02:55.402]'You've probably woken up everyone in the village as well.
[03:01.653]Still, I'm glad the bell is working again.'
[03:15.232]‘That's the trouble, vicar,' answered Bill.
[03:21.306]'It's working all right, but I'm afraid that at one o'clock it will strike thirteen times and there's nothing I can do about it."
[03:55.080]‘We'll get used to that, Bill,' said the vicar.
[04:01.808]'Thirteen is not as good as one, but it's better than nothing.
[04:10.212]Now let's go downstairs and have a cup of tear.'
